Buying Guide

Match pump type to task

Choose a hand siphon for small transfers or bilge work, a submersible for standing-water removal, and a portable motorized pump for higher flow needs like draining pools or tanks

Check flow rate and power

Compare GPM or GPH and motor horsepower—higher flow (GPM/GPH) and motor ratings generally move water faster but may require AC power or larger batteries

Confirm fuel and fluid compatibility

For fuel transfer pick pumps explicitly rated for gasoline or diesel; water-transfer models typically specify potable or non-potable use and chemical compatibility

Consider hose length and fittings

Longer hoses and common fittings reduce the need for adapters; verify included hose length and diameter to suit your containers and outlets

Assess portability and power source

Hand pumps and lightweight electric units are easier to move; check whether a unit is corded 115V, battery-powered, or manual based on jobsite access to electricity
